Ny til Programmering

Tags:    diverse

Hej.
Jeg er ny og kunne godt tænke mig at prøve at lære at lave programmer. Jeg vil gerne vide hvilket sprog i vil sige der er det bedste til en newb. det skal ikke være til web. Og hvad skal jeg så bruge ud over sproget i sig selv. Det må gerne være gratis hvis det er mulligt men bare kom med det bedste forslag.

MVH
Alexander

Ps. håber at tråden ligger rigtig.



Jeg må ærligt tilstå jeg ikke har prøvet det særlig meget, men har hørt super mange gode ting om Python og faldt over det her i går : http://www.crunchcourse.com/class/mit-opencourseware-600-introduction/2010/jan/ . Det er et begynderkursus i programmering med Python som sprog. Og det Python kan bruges til en masse. Giv det en kigger



Jeg ville nok starte med Java (måske C# vis du er på windows).

Det eneste du behøver for at programmere Java er JDK'et som kan downloades gratis. Jeg tror det er en god ide at skrive nogle få programmer med så få hjælpe midler som muligt(kun JDK'et og en teksteditor(måske med syntax highlihtinng)) sådan man finder ud af hvordan det fungere. Så kan man hurtigt begynde at bruge et IDE(et program der hjælper en med at kode). Der findes en masse gratis Java IDE'er. Min favorit er eclipse, af andre kan nævnes netbeans.



Jeg ville nok starte med Java (måske C# vis du er på windows).

Det eneste du behøver for at programmere Java er JDK'et som kan downloades gratis. Jeg tror det er en god ide at skrive nogle få programmer med så få hjælpe midler som muligt(kun JDK'et og en teksteditor(måske med syntax highlihtinng)) sådan man finder ud af hvordan det fungere. Så kan man hurtigt begynde at bruge et IDE(et program der hjælper en med at kode). Der findes en masse gratis Java IDE'er. Min favorit er eclipse, af andre kan nævnes netbeans.


Som en anden måde at gå på kan du også prøve at se på C++, det har måske en sværere læringskurve end C# og Java, men det har da også sine fordele.

Det er dog mest til spil, til programmer vil jeg foreslå enten C# (Hvis du kun vil kode til Windows) eller Java hvis du vil prøve flere platforme (Inklusiv mobiltelefoner)



Det giver ikke meget mening at lave spil i C++ medmindre man er erfaren nok til at benytte alle fordelene og ens spil har bruge for de fordele.

Vis man er ny og skal lave spil er C# med XNA godt vis man er på windows. Ellers (selvom jeg ikke har prøvet det) måske python med pygame.

Men det er en god ide at sætte sig ind i hvordan pointers osv. fungere i C++ når man bliver bedre.



Det lyder godt, men hvad skal jeg bruge til de forskellige. Vil gerne have et link



JDK: http://java.sun.com/javase/downloads/index.jsp (netbeans kan også hentes her)
Eclipse: http://www.eclipse.org/downloads/ (vis du download eclipse for java developers følger JDk'et vidst nok med)

Vis du vil programmere C# med .NET bliver du nok nødt til at have fat i IDE'et visual C#: http://www.microsoft.com/express/Downloads/#2008-Visual-CS

Men det er ikke så svært at google. Søg foreksempel efter python på google vis du hellere vil bruge det. Du kommer til at bruge google rigtigt meget når du går igang med at programmere, så du kan ligesågodt starte nu :D



ok tak for svaret. jeg vil egynde med java da det lyder til at være godt at starte med




t